Key Features of the BabyDoppler App:

  • Capture and Share Heartbeat Sounds: Record and easily share your baby's heartbeat with loved ones.
  • Daily Pregnancy Guidance: Receive daily tips and valuable information to keep you informed and prepared.
  • Heartbeat and Kick Tracking Reminders: Set convenient reminders to ensure you don't miss important moments.
  • Visualize Your Baby's Growth: Follow your baby's development with images showcasing their progress and size comparisons.
  • Access Previous Recordings: Easily review and listen to previous recordings of your baby's heartbeat.
  • Comprehensive Kick Counter: Accurately track your baby's movements and review a detailed summary log.
